Ohioan
noun [ C ] uk/əʊˈhaɪ.əʊ.ən/ us/oʊˈhaɪ.oʊ.ən/
俄亥俄州人
someone from the US state of Ohio
The new X-ray machine was invented by Ohioan Thomas Edison. 新的X光机是由俄亥俄州人托马斯 · 爱迪生发明的。
Any Ohioan who graduated from high school could go to Ohio State University as long as there was room. 只要大学还有空位,任何俄亥俄州的高中毕业生都可以去俄亥俄州立大学。

Ohioan
adjective uk/əʊˈhaɪ.əʊ.ən/ us/oʊˈhaɪ.oʊ.ən/
俄亥俄州的;俄亥俄州人的
belonging or relating to the US state of Ohio or its people
The family moved to the Ohioan capital, Columbus. 这家人搬到俄亥俄州首府哥伦布去了。
Ohioan farmers could easily ship crops all the way to the East Coast. 俄亥俄州的农民可以很容易地把收获的粮食一路运到东海岸。
